Then what is Demon's Souls and on what does it treat? Well, if you are wondering on of what the history goes, here go an advance child about what it treats:
King Allant the XIIth, the last king of Boletaria, thought about how to expand untiringly his power. Nexus, a sanctum of big blocks of ice placed in the mountains, granted him the power of the souls this way to be able to take the prosperity to his kingdom. Still unsatisfied, it returned again to Nexus, where stupidly he woke up the Ancestral Demon of his eternal sleep. It is forgotten badly, now it is forged in Boletaria, plunging to the kingdom in the darkness and the fog. A powerful demonis horde is spilled in the kingdom, devouring the souls of the men.
Champions of other kingdoms found out about the Boletaria luck and trataraon of not delivering the kingdom to the demons, but none would return from the damned ground. Called by a mysterious young woman with completely black outfits, the last hope for the humanity in a place lost to the demons and the darkness...
